🌟 Cherokee County Spring Break Camps
Spring break camps are a fantastic way to keep children engaged, active, and socially connected during their time off from school. Cherokee County offers an impressive variety of camps catering to different interests, from outdoor adventures and sports to arts and specialized activities.
Cherokee Recreation & Parks Spring Into Action Camp
Location: Two locations - Woodstock @ The WREC (7545 Main St, Woodstock) and Canton @ The BUZZ (7345 Cumming Hwy, Canton)
Dates: March 31-April 4, 2025
Hours: Monday-Friday, 7:00 AM - 6:00 PM
Ages: 5-12
Cost: $225 per camper
Description: Full-day camp with various activities to keep children active and engaged
Registration: playcherokee.org
Cherokee Recreation & Parks Outdoor Camp
Location: Multiple facilities with scheduled activities at The WREC Pavilion and CRPA Vehicles
Dates: March 31-April 4, 2025
Hours: 9:00 AM - 4:00 PM weekdays
Ages: 9-13
Cost: $225
Description: Adventure-based activities including hiking, kayaking, fishing, team building, indoor climbing/archery, and ropes course
Note: Campers should bring lunch, water, and sunscreen daily
Registration: playcherokee.org
CCAC Splish Splash Camp (Aquatics)
Location: Cherokee County Aquatic Center
Dates: March 31-April 4, 2025
Hours: 7:30 AM - 6:00 PM weekdays
Ages: 5-12
Cost: $255
Description: Swimming, games, field trips, arts and crafts with swim instructors
Notes: Three-day participants get one field trip; five-day participants get two field trips
Contact: Amanda Lane at [email protected] or 678-880-4760
Registration: playcherokee.org

🚗 Top Day Trip Ideas (Within 3 Hours)
One of the advantages of living in Cherokee County is our strategic location with easy access to a wealth of world-class attractions just a short drive away. These excursions can transform an ordinary spring break into an extraordinary one, exposing children to educational, cultural, and recreational experiences that expand their horizons.
Outdoor Adventures & Nature Escapes
Tallulah Gorge State Park
Location: Tallulah Falls, GA (2 hrs from Cherokee County)
Activities: Hike the gorge, walk the suspension bridge, and picnic by waterfalls
Perfect for: Families who enjoy moderate hiking and dramatic natural scenery
Amicalola Falls State Park
Location: Dawsonville, GA (1.5 hrs from Cherokee County)
Activities: See Georgia's tallest waterfall, enjoy beginner-friendly hiking trails, and visit the fun visitor center
Website: https://amicalolafallslodge.com/
Cloudland Canyon State Park
Location: Rising Fawn, GA (2 hrs from Cherokee County)
Activities: Explore epic canyons, waterfalls, and trails—less crowded than other parks
Best for: Families seeking impressive views with moderate effort
Animal Encounters
North Georgia Wildlife Park & Safari
Location: Cleveland, GA (1.5 hrs from Cherokee County)
Activities: Petting zoo plus exotic animal safari
Appeal: Extremely popular with children of all ages
Yellow River Wildlife Sanctuary
Location: Lilburn, GA (1.25 hrs from Cherokee County)
Activities: Feed deer, goats, and more in a super walkable park
Perfect for: Families with younger children who want to interact with animals
Zoo Atlanta
Location: Atlanta, GA
Activities: Wide variety of animals in naturalistic settings
Notes: Plan to spend at least half a day here
Thrill & Theme Parks
Six Flags Over Georgia
Location: Austell, GA (1.25 hrs from Cherokee County)
Activities: Roller coasters for teens, kiddie rides for younger children
Tip: Check website for spring break special hours and promotions
Lanier Islands
Location: Buford, GA (1.5 hrs from Cherokee County)
Activities: Beach-like vibes, water play (if warm), boat rentals, and walking trails
Good for: A relaxed outdoor day with options for all ages
Hands-On & Educational Attractions
Tellus Science Museum
Location: Cartersville, GA (1 hr from Cherokee County)
Activities: Planetarium, dinosaur fossils, and interactive science exhibits
Appeal: Educational yet genuinely fun for the whole family
Booth Western Art Museum
Location: Cartersville, GA (1 hr from Cherokee County)
Activities: Art meets the Wild West, includes kids play area in the basement
Surprisingly: Very engaging for families, not just art enthusiasts
Georgia Aquarium + Centennial Park
Location: Atlanta, GA (1 hr from Cherokee County)
Activities: Pair the aquarium with playgrounds, World of Coca-Cola, and SkyView Ferris wheel
Tip: Make a full day in downtown Atlanta, visiting multiple attractions

🏘️ Charming Small Towns to Explore
These towns all feature walkable main streets, family-friendly atmospheres, and unique attractions that make them perfect for day trips during spring break.
Blue Ridge, GA (1.5 hrs)
Train rides, hiking, boutique shops, and waterfalls nearby
Dahlonega, GA (1.25 hrs)
Gold rush history, gem mining, walkable square, cute cafés
Ellijay, GA (1 hr)
Apple houses, mountain views, antique stores, and charming downtown
Helen, GA (1.75 hrs)
Bavarian-style village, fudge shops, mini-golf, tubing (if warm), and nearby hiking trails
Clayton, GA (2 hrs)
Gateway to Black Rock Mountain, downtown charm, numerous nearby waterfalls
Blairsville, GA (2 hrs)
Vogel State Park, scenic drives, and old-school general stores
Hiawassee, GA (2.5 hrs)
Lake Chatuge views, Georgia Mountain Fairgrounds, and excellent hiking options
Chickamauga, GA (2 hrs)
Civil War battlefield, charming small-town square, historical sites
Madison, GA (1.5 hrs)
Beautiful historic homes, small town strolls, and great food options
Cleveland, GA (1.5 hrs)
Home of Babyland General (Cabbage Patch Kids) and wildlife park
Senoia, GA (2 hrs)
Filming location of The Walking Dead, cozy coffee shops, and stroll-worthy downtown
Greenville, SC (2.5 hrs)
Gorgeous riverwalk, Falls Park, interactive children's museum
Chattanooga, TN (2 hrs)
Small city feel but walkable with family attractions including aquarium, riverside activities, and Lookout Mountain

📝 Tips for a Great Spring Break
✅ Plan early – Many camps and activities require pre-registration, and popular options fill up quickly.
✅ Mix it up – Combine structured activities like day camps with free time for relaxation and spontaneous adventures.
✅ Weather-proof – Spring weather can be unpredictable, so have indoor backup plans for rainy days.
✅ Pack smart – For day camps and outdoor activities, ensure kids have plenty of water, sunscreen, appropriate clothing, and healthy snacks.
✅ Use discounts – Look for multi-child discounts at camps and attractions, and special offers for educators and first responders.
✅ Carpool opportunities – Connect with other families to share transportation duties for camps and activities.
✅ Document the fun – Create a spring break photo challenge or journal to capture memories of your adventures.
✅ Support local – Don't overlook the charm of our local downtowns in Woodstock, Canton, and Ball Ground for shopping, treats, and casual dining.
